Harold Lee Miller, age 92, of Carroll, OH died July 20, 2018. He was born May 24, 1926 in Groveport, OH to the late Raymond and Leona Miller. He proudly served in the United States Navy. Harold was a graduate of Groveport High School and the Ohio State University. Retired school teacher and coach from Bloom-Carrol School District and served on the Bloom-Carroll School Board. He was a charter member of the Ohio Golf Course Owners Assoc. (Buckeye Golf Course Assoc.) and a member of Groveport Zion Lutheran Church.

Preceded in death by his wife, Nelda Miller; six siblings, Raymond Miller Jr., Charles Miller, who died in active duty during WWII, Blanche Allen, Neil Miller, Richard Miller and Shirley Swartzlander; sister and brother-in-law, Ila and Robert Peters. Survivors include his daughter, Ila (William) Sloan; grandson, Jason Cover; great grand dog, Loki; special family, Trent, Stefanie, Grant and Sofie Sheridan; numerous nieces, nephews and the Pine Hill family.
